WILLIAM was born on May 27, 1930 in For Smith, Arkansas.
Graduated from Northeast High School in 1948.
Enlisted in the Air Force in 1951, receiving his Wings and Commission in October 1952 and was on active duty until October
1955.
Received a Bachelor of Arts degree from Baylor University in 1956.
Received LL>B degree from Baylor University of Law in 1958.
He practed law in Waco, Texas from 1958-1969 and then left to become a member of the Department of Justice in Washington,
D.C. He was Chief of the Government Operations Section, Criminal Division.
He was appointed United States District Judge for the same area in 1974. He became Chief Judge of that court in 1980.
He served on both the State Bar of Texas and the Judicial Conference of the United States.
He resigned his position as District Judge to become the FBI Director on November 1, 1987.
